When the chief priests, the elders and the teachers of the law came and challenged My Son concerning by what authority He had done His miracles, My Son certainly knew immediately of their hypocrisy and their false intentions. For had He not declared on a number of occasions that He had been sent from Me and that the works that He did were by My authority and power, and even that they were indeed My works? And you will recall that He also said that if they refused to believe His teaching, they should believe because of the works, not only because they were miraculous, but because they bore the stamp of My character in extending mercy, healing and deliverance to those who were needy and who were bound in darkness. So you see that having made these things plain in what He had declared before this, He knew that behind their inquiry was an effort to ensnare and discredit Him. And so you see in His initial question regarding the baptism of John, that His main objective is to expose their hypocrisy and thus discount the sincerity of their intentions and to resist submitting to their demand for an answer to their challenging question. And you see in the inquiries that follow the continuation of this evil and hypocritical attempt on the part of those who questioned Him, namely the spies who pretended to be honest and the Sadducees who asked a question that involved a concern for what would be in the resurrection when they did not believe in the resurrection. And you see that in the parable My Son clearly not only exposed their evil intent, but showed that their rejection actually, according to My Word, confirmed that they were in effect, by rejecting Him, both proving that He indeed was My Son and that they were opposing Me. And not only this, but there awaited for them certain judgment because of their rejection and opposition. You see that the declaration of this truth and the warning of the consequences of their attitude and actions did not change them, but actually made them more determined to do away with My Son.
And you see in two of these instances, that is in the question about John’s baptism and in their reaction to His parable, they were clearly exposed as men pleasers rather than God pleasers. In the end, when My Son asked them a question, you see that they have no genuine response because His question put before them again the truth of My Word. And their actions and their motivations were not directed by My Word. Once again My Son warns of their judgment, but this time the warning is to His disciples.
